SBR FOOD CH 1027 for chew gum base
SBR is widely used in chewing gum base and bubble gum base applications. It is most suitable for gum with a firmer chew, as well as for bubble gum where large bubble size and stability are highly desirable. It is also used in other food contact applications, such as food can sealant.

SSBR-CH 1027 is a food grade SSBR. Which is produced by hexane solution, the solution copolymerization of butadiene and styrene. Using butyllithium as catalyst, the solvents and volatiles are removed by hot water, dewaterer and expander . It is an equivalent of SBR FOOD-CH 1027. Which used in bubble/chewing gum base and food contact.

Gum Base is a non-nutritive masticatory substance (US FDA, “Code of Federal Regulation”).
It is an inert and insoluble non-nutritive product used as a support for the edible and soluble
portion of the chewing gum (sugar, glucose, polyols and flavours). The general description
“Gum Base”, used on chewing gum products throughout the world, is recognised by The
Food Chemicals Codex and most national legislation.

1. What is gum base?
Gum base is what gives chewing gum its “chew.” It is made of a combination of food-grade polymers, waxes and softeners that give gum the texture desired by consumers and enable it to effectively deliver sweetness, flavor and various other benefits, including dental benefits.
2. What are polymers? A polymer is a string of molecules (monomers) that usually contain carbon and hydrogen. Polymers are found naturally in the human body, animals, plants, and minerals. For example, DNA is a polymer, as are the proteins and starches in the foods we eat. Man-made polymers can be identical in structure to those found in the natural environment, but in many cases, these polymers provide guaranteed consistency, quality and purity that are not always found in some natural materials. This quality is particularly important for food-grade polymers used as ingredients.
3. What are food-grade polymers?
Food-grade polymers have been rigorously tested and have been determined to be safe for use in food. In chewing gum, polymers are what provide gum with its basic elastic properties. All polymers used in gum are food-grade and are legally permitted for use by international/national regulatory agencies, including those in the U.S., Europe, and Asia.
Main ingredients of gum base
Gum base is the non-nutritive, non-digestible, water insoluble masticator delivery system used to carry sweeteners, flavors and any other desired substances in chewing gum and bubble gum. Its generally consists of ingredients are: Food grade rubber, ester gum, microcrystalline wax, emulsifiers, fillers, antioxidants

GUM BASE Product Description:
Gum base is made of food-grade plasticizers, softeners, texturizers and emulsifiers among other ingredients, which impart their unique properties to chewing gum. It is an insoluble and non-nutritive, non-digestible, water-insoluble substance that enables a chewing gum to be chewed for hours without experiencing substantial changes.
Gum Base can be combined with acid or non-acid flavoring, sugar or sugar substitutes as well as vitamins or active ingredient in chewing gum, bubble gum and pharmaceutical products.
